What is Local Emergency Boarding?
Local emergency boarding refers to a temporary housing service that is provided by various organizations, consisting of government firms, non-profits, and often personal entities, throughout emergencies. This service is created to provide instant shelter to people and households displaced due to numerous unpredicted situations, consisting of:
Natural disasters (typhoons, floods, wildfires)Building evacuations due to fires, security hazards, or other emergenciesDomestic violence scenariosHealth-related crises (pandemics)Displacement due to substantial facilities failures
These boarding services are typically used complimentary of charge or at a minimal expense, ensuring that those in need have access to safe and secure housing.

What to Expect at Emergency Boarding Facilities
Individuals looking for emergency boarding should be gotten ready for the following aspects at these centers:
Basic Living Arrangements: Most emergency boarding setups supply standard sleeping arrangements frequently shared among several individuals.
Meals and Hygiene Facilities: Access to meals is frequently offered, in addition to basic health facilities to preserve individual care.
Assistance Services: Many shelters use services such as mental health therapy, monetary assistance programs, and resources to aid with longer-term housing solutions.
Restrictions and Rules: It is vital to comprehend that these facilities frequently have specific rules concerning check-in/check-out times, visitor policies, and behavior requirements in order to preserve security and order.

The duration of stay differs by center. Some may allow stays for a couple of days, while others may accommodate individuals for weeks, depending upon their policies and available resources.
What if I have pets?
Lots of emergency shelters do not enable family pets for health and wellness reasons. However, some organizations may have provisions or partnerships with family pet shelters to accommodate people with animals. It's finest to check ahead of time.
Are there services for kids offered in emergency shelters?
A lot of emergency shelters aim to provide services for households with children, consisting of childcare and academic resources. However, the schedule of such services may vary.
